Flu Shots Available for Michigan Medicine Employees

Get your flu shot before December 1!

Under the organization’s influenza vaccination policy, faculty, staff, students and volunteers must receive their annual vaccine by December 1, 2018 or receive an approved exemption or declination. Those with an approved exemption or declination will be required to wear a mask in patient care areas for the entire flu season.

There are many opportunities to get your flu shot at Michigan Medicine, including free flu clinics across the medical campus beginning on October 1. Vaccines are also available at Occupational Health Services in the Med Inn Building or from clinical unit flu liaisons. Make sure to have your ID badge when you arrive and you’ll receive a sticker for your ID badge after getting the shot.
